Wednesday, August 22nd, 2007If you see the dialog box asking what you want to do with theCD, click Copy pictures to a folder on my computer…. Then go toStep 2. Otherwise, you ll automatically be taken to Step 2. If absolutely nothing happens within a minute of insertingthe CD into its drive, you can access the disk directly fromits icon in My Computer. See the section Using CDs andDVDs in Chapter 21 for more information. 2.The Scanner and Camera Wizard opens. Click the Next button on thefirst page of the Wizard. The Choose Pictures to Copy page opens. Initially, all pictures are selected for copying, as in Figure 14-2. Ifthere are any pictures you don t want to copy, clear their check- marks. Then click Next. Figure 14-2:Choosing pictures to copy from a CD3.The next page asks what you want to name the group of pictures andwhere you want to put them. Type a brief, descriptive name of yourown choosing, like 2003 Christmas or Mandy s New Do. The name youenter will be the name of the folder in which the pictures are stored. Click Next. 4.The next Wizard page shows you the program s progress. Nothing todo there but wait. When all the pictures have been copied, the OtherOptions page opens. 5.On the Other Options page, choose Nothing; then click Next. On thelast Wizard page that opens, click Finish. The folder on your hard drive will open. You can remove the CD now and put for safe keeping. From now on, you ll do all your work on the copiesin the folder on your hard disk. The CD will just be a backup of your originalphotos, in case you ever want to recopy an original photo to your hard disk.
